Finding the Right Roofing Contractor for Your Home

Finding the Right Roofing Contractor for Your Home
Source: Unsplash

A sturdy roof is crucial for protecting your home from the elements, and finding a roofing contractor makes all the difference in the quality and longevity of your investment. In this article, we explore how homeowners can make the best choice when selecting a roofing professional for their needs.

Determine Your Roofing Needs

Before searching for a contractor, identify your roofing needs. Are you looking for a simple repair, a complete replacement, or something in between? Be sure to consider factors such as the type of roofing material, the age of your roof, and the seFor example, flatty of damage. Flat roof repair may require a different skillset and expertise than replacing a shingle roof.

Research Local Roofing Contractors

Start by searching for local roofing contractors in your area. Look for businesses with a solid reputation and a proven track record of success. Some ways to find reputable contractors include:

● Asking friends, family, and neighbors for recommendations
● Reading online reviews and testimonials
● Consulting local business directories or the Better Business Bureau

Verify Licenses and Insurance

Roofing work can be dangerous, and choosing a contractor with the proper licenses and insurance coverage is essential. A roofing contractor must hold a valid license to operate legally in most areas. Additionally, they should carry both general liability insurance to cover potential property damage and workers’ compensation insurance to protect employees in case of injury. Therefore, always ask for proof of licenses and insurance before agreeing to work with a contractor.

Obtain Multiple Quotes

When selecting a roofing contractor, gathering quotes from different companies is important. This will ensure you have a clear picture of pricing trends in your area. Avoid choosing a contractor based solely on price. A low bid might be tempting, but it could indicate a lack of experience, subpar materials, or cutting corners on the job.

Evaluate Communication and Professionalism

How a contractor communicates with you can be a strong indicator of their professionalism and the quality of work you can expect. A reliable contractor will be responsive to your inquiries, provide clear explanations, and patiently address any concerns you may have. However, be cautious of contractors who are pushy, vague, or unwilling contractors to answer your questions.

Check References and Portfolio

A reputable roofing contractor should provide references from previous clients. Contact these references and ask about their experience with the contractor, including their work quality and overall satisfaction. Additionally, request a portfolio of the contractor’s past projects to assess the quality of their work and ensure they have experience with projects similar to yours.

Review the Contract and Warranty

Before signing a contract, read through it carefully and ensure it includes all relevant details, such as the scope of work, materials to be used, and a timeline for completion. Additionally, inquire about the warranty offered for both materials and workmanship. A comprehensive warranty can provide peace of mind and protect your investment long-term.


Selecting the right roofing contractor for your home is a critical decision that requires careful consideration. Determining your roofing needs, researching local contractors, verifying licenses and insurance, obtaining multiple quotes, evaluating communication and professionalism, checking references and portfolios, and reviewing the contract and warranty can ensure a successful project and a roof that will stand the test of time.

About the author

Saman Iqbal

Saman is a law student. She enjoys writing about tech, politics and the world in general. She's an avid reader and writes fictional prose in her free time.

Daily Newsletter